One Day at Teton Marsh is a fascinating exploration of wildlife in the shadow of the Grand Teton Mountains. It has this serene, almost meditative quality, showcasing various animals like ospreys and otters in their natural habitats. The pacing feels leisurely, allowing viewers to soak in the atmosphere and really connect with the scenes. Practical effects are evident, and the cinematography captures the essence of the marshland beautifully. It's a different kind of adventure, focusing less on plot and more on the rhythm of nature and its inhabitants, which makes it distinctive. The performances, while not traditional, evoke a genuine respect for the environment, making it a unique watch for those interested in nature documentaries.
